Microsoft has had some great licensing success stories. For instance, with Windows. Many computer manufacturers license Windows to pre - install on their devices. This has made Windows the dominant operating system in the PC market. It gives computer users a familiar and widely - supported system, and it has been a major source of revenue for Microsoft for a long time.

Sure. Spotify is a great example. Their MVP offered a basic music - streaming service. It had a relatively small music library at first but provided a seamless listening experience. This attracted music lovers who were tired of downloading songs. As they got more users, they were able to expand their library and improve their algorithms for personalized playlists, which contributed to their huge success today.

In the tech industry, Dropbox is a well - known success story in direct marketing. They started with a simple referral program where users could get extra storage space for referring new users. This word - of - mouth marketing was extremely effective and helped them gain a large user base quickly. Another is Spotify. Their use of personalized playlists and targeted ads based on users' music preferences has been a big part of their direct marketing success. They also offer free and premium tiers which are marketed directly to different segments of users.
